West of Zanzibar (1928)





Lon Chaney goes cripple again for the sake of the public, but not for art's sake. Remembering his fine performance in a straight role in "Tell it to the Marines," it seems a great pity that such a good actor should indulge in charlatan tricks. The story is a composite of "The Shanghai Gesture" and "Congo." Revenge, dope, crooks — all the tricks! There is color and little else. It is all very false and movie.

Photoplay November 1928
